In most countries, enlisting in the military is not mandatory. However, there are countries with mandatory military service laws that require all eligible citizens to serve in the military for a specified period. It's important to check the requirements and laws of your specific country to understand if military service is mandatory or voluntary.

militia is a group of all able-bodied males considered by law eligible for military service.
The militia. In the United States Code, the "militia" are divided into two classes; the "organized militia", which is the National Guard and all former military members, and the "unorganized militia" who is everybody else up to age 45 who might be eligible for military service.
